> We noticed inconsistency regarding index an entry. When we created a new entry and assigned a future publish date, the entry will be indexed because the status of the entry is "PUBLISHED" and become searchable immediately. It caused the search result page to report wrong number. However, the result page does not show the entry because the page model filters out the result by date and the future date is filtered out. There is no status to indicate an entry is approved to be published but its time is not due yet. When the time is due, there is no action to kick of search to index this newly published entry.
